Neeraj Kumar wrote:
> CXL 3.2 Spec mentions CXL LSA 2.1 Namespace Labels at section
> 9.13.2.5. If Namespace label is present in LSA during
> nvdimm_probe() then dimm-physical-address(DPA) reservation is
> required. But this reservation is not required by cxl region
> label. Therefore if LSA scanning finds any region label, skip it.
